Brief Summary
The aim of this study is to compare the effects of Schroth 3D exercise method on home symmetry, trunk topography, scapula symmetry, pelvic symmetry, health related quality of life and cosmetic deformity perception in adolescents with idiopathic scoliosis

Outcome Measures
Primary Outcomes (5)
Root Mean Square(RMS)
Body right and left asymmetry will be examined.
12 weeks
3D Motion analysis
3D motion analysis with 4 cameras, symmetry of certain points will be evaluated during motion.
12 weeks
Postural Trunk Asymmetry Index (POTSI)
It is a method that allows an individual with AIS to evaluate body shape and asymmetry.
12 weeks
Walter Reed Visuel Assesment Scale
Walter Reed Visuel Assesment Scale (WRVAS) each aspect is shown with five levels of increasing severity of the seven type of deformity that are scored from minimum (1) to maximum (5). How individuals perceive their own cosmetic deformities and the effectiveness of treatment in improving cosmetic deformity can be evaluated
12 weeks
Scoliosis Research Society-22
Scoliosis Research Society (SRS-22) is a simple and practical questionnaire specific to individuals with scoliosis. The questionnaire included pain, self-image, function / activity, mental health and treatment satisfaction. There are 22 questionnaire questions, scoring from 1 to 5. The minimum score is the worst score (22).
12 weeks
